Court Extends Seun Kuti’s Detention By 4 Days

May 19, (THEWILL) – Seun Kuti’s detention has been extended by a Sabo-Yaba Chief Magistrates’ Court, in Lagos, on Thursday.

The court granted the application for an extension of remand of the embattled singer for an additional four days.

The Chief Magistrate, Mrs Adeola Olatubosun, extended Kuti’s remand until May 22.

Mr. Simon Lough, who led a police legal team to the court, had moved the application.

According to him, the extension is to allow for further investigation into the case.

Kuti was charged with assaulting a police officer when he allegedly slapped an Inspector of Police on May 13, 2023.

He was earlier arraigned, on Tuesday, May 16, 2023, during which the Chief Magistrate ordered his remand for 48 hours.

She, however, held that the defendant should be admitted to bail in the sum of N1 million with two sureties in like sum at the end of the 48-hour remand, stating that one of the sureties must be a landlord within the jurisdiction of the court.

She adjourned the case till May 22, 2023, for mention and directed the prosecutor to duplicate the case file and forward a copy to the State Director of Public Prosecutions for advice.
